Job Summary
- Site technology Transfer:
- Internal product technology transfers from an Apotex manufacturing site to Apotex research privatelimited (ARPL) India.
- Transfer of products from Small Volume Manufacturing Plant to Large Volume Manufacturing Plantand Vice versa within ARPL.
- Technology transfer of New products:
- New product transfer from formulation development to commercial scale.
- Manufacturing process support: Technical support for the trouble shooting of processing issues in Commercial batch manufacturing.
- Product Life cycle Management (PLCM) : Technical support to ensure robustness of product/process through out its life cycle.
- Supplier driven changes (SDC) : Change or addition of a source or supplier driven change in raw material (API & Excipients) manufacturing process for existing commercial products.
- Documentation: Documentation support for the MTS activities.
- All other relevant duties as assigned.
